Dataset: Expression data from mouse gastric tumor models

Transgenic mice with prostaglandin E2 pathway in stomach develops gastric tumors. Simultaneous activation of both Wnt pathway and prostaglandin E2 pathway causes gastric adenocarcinoma. Combination of prostaglandin E2 pathway activation and suppression of BMP pathway leads to the development of gastric hamartomas. We used microarrays to find the mechanism of these tumor development and to evaluate whether these mouse models recapitulate human gastric tumors. Glandular stomach from three C57BL/6 wild-type, five K19-Wnt1 transgenic, three K19-C2mE, five K19-Wnt1/C2mE, two K19-Nog, and three K19-Nog/C2mE transgenic mice were used. All mice were female at 18-65 weeks of age.
